Welspun One Logistics Parks (WOLP), an integrated fund and development management platform, has announced a build-to-suit lease agreement with Montra Electric (from TIVOLT), the 4-Wheeler electric vehicle manufacturer of the Murugappa Group.
Under this partnership, Welspun One will construct a build-to-suit (BTS) facility, encompassing Montra Electric’s (from TIVOLT) retail experience center and a dedicated assembly space tailored for four-wheeler small commercial EVs. Located within the Welspun One logistics and warehousing park in Chinnambedu, Chennai, the facility is projected to commence operations by the second quarter of 2024.
The mixed-use development spans over 3 lakh sq. ft., which includes 50,000 sq. ft. of open space. The facility is customised to meet Montra Electric’s (from TIVOLT) precise requirements, ensuring exceptional accessibility and specialised finished goods storage solutions, among other features.
The project is part of an Rs 2,500 crores investment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) signed by Welspun One with the Government of Tamil Nadu, further underlining the company’s commitment to fostering regional economic growth.
